摘要
对江西某难选铜钼硫多金属矿进行了浮选试验研究。采用铜钼等可浮-强化选铜-尾矿选硫的工艺流程,可获得铜钼混合精矿铜品位18.27%、钼品位0.45%,铜回收率81.03%、钼回收率59.83%,以及硫精矿品位47.32%、硫回收率85.58%的选别指标,实现了铜钼硫的综合回收。
Flotation tests were conducted for a refractory copper-molybdenum-sulfur ore from Jiangxi.By adopting a flowsheet consisting of Cu-Mo iso-flotation,intensified Cu flotation and S flotation from the tailings,a copper-molybdenum bulk concentrate grading 18.27% Cu and 0.45% Mo at corresponding recoveries of 81.03% and 59.83%,and a sulfur concentrate grading 47.32% S at 85.58% recovery were obtained.Thus,the comprehensive recovery of Cu,Mo and S can be realized by using this flotation process.
